Method

Proteins

  1. 1

    Bacon (oven method)

    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Arrange bacon slices on wire racks set over sheet pans (or directly on parchment-lined sheet pans) in a single layer. Bake 15–20 minutes, rotating pans once, until bacon is crisped to your liking. Transfer to paper towels to drain. Keep warm in a low oven (200°F/95°C) on sheet pans lined with paper towels.

  2. 2

    Sausage Patties

    Preheat a large griddle or skillet over medium heat. Place sausage patties in a single layer and cook 4–6 minutes per side (internal temperature 160°F/71°C), flipping once, until browned and cooked through. If catering for a crowd, cook in batches and hold cooked patties in a hotel pan covered with foil in a 200°F oven to keep warm.

  3. 3

    Scrambled Eggs (large batch, steam-pan method)

    Whisk eggs, milk, 1 tsp salt, and 1 tsp pepper in a very large bowl until blended but not foamy. Heat a well-seasoned 18–24" steam table pan (or very large sauté pan) over medium-low and add 6 tbsp butter, swirling to coat. Pour in 12 eggs at a time (or an amount that allows gentle stirring) and allow to sit undisturbed 20–30 seconds until edges begin to set. Using a rubber spatula, gently push the eggs from the edges to the center, forming large soft curds. When eggs are mostly set but still glossy and slightly wet, remove from heat and finish with 1–2 tbsp butter and a sprinkle of salt and pepper. Transfer to holding pan and repeat with remaining eggs. Hold covered in a 160–170°F (71–77°C) oven; stir once before serving and garnish with chopped chives if desired.

Grits or Potatoes

  1. 4

    Grits (stovetop, serves ~24)

    Bring 12 cups water and 3 cups milk to a simmer in a large heavy-bottomed pot. Add 2 tsp salt. Slowly whisk in 6 cups grits to avoid lumps. Reduce heat to low and simmer, stirring frequently, 15–20 minutes (follow package for exact timing) until thick and creamy. Stir in 1/2 cup butter and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per to taste. Keep warm in a steam table pan over low heat; stir occasionally to prevent skin forming.

  2. 5

    Roasted Breakfast Potatoes (alternative)

    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Toss 8 lbs diced yellow potatoes with 3/4 cup olive oil, 2 tsp smoked paprika, 2 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p salt, and 1 tsp pepper in large bowls until evenly coated. Spread in an even layer on sheet pans (use multiple pans; do not overcrowd). Roast 25–35 minutes, turning once halfway, until potatoes are golden and tender. Finish with 1/4 cup chopped parsley. Keep warm in hotel pans covered with foil.

Toast or Biscuits

  1. 6

    Toast

    If serving toast: preheat conveyor toaster or oven to medium-high. Toast 48 slices of bread until golden. Butter lightly and stack in small batches to keep warm; cover with a clean towel or place in covered hotel pans to hold for service.

  2. 7

    Biscuits

    If serving biscuits: heat prepared or store-bought buttermilk biscuits per package or bake fresh according to recipe (typically 400°F/200°C for 12–15 minutes for 12 biscuits; scale timing and pans accordingly for 36 biscuits). Keep warm in covered hotel pans.

Finishing & Service

  1. 8

    Arrange plated or buffet-style: place bacon and sausage in separate hotel pans, scrambled eggs in a shallow pan, grits or potatoes in their own pan, and toast or biscuits on lined trays. Provide bowls of maple syrup and hot sauce, butter for toast, and a sprinkle of chopped chives over eggs. Replenish pans from warmers as needed and keep hot items at safe holding temperatures (above 140°F/60°C).

  2. 9

    Portioning guideline: For catering 24 servings use quantities listed. Typical portions per person: 2 slices bacon, 1 sausage patty, 1/2–3/4 cup grits or 1 cup roasted potatoes, 2 large scrambled eggs, and 2 slices toast or 1 biscuit.
